Secrets of a Tahitian Pearl Farm

The gentle caress upon the turquoise waters of Tahiti reveals an hidden realm. Within these tranquil lagoons, nestled amidst swaying coral reefs and vibrant marine life, lie secret gardens – Tahitian pearl farms. These operations are at which nature's artistry takes center stage, transforming humble oysters into shimmering treasures. The craft of cultivating pearls is a delicate process, demanding patience, expertise, and a deep connection for the ocean's intricate rhythms.

  • Stories tell of ancient Tahitian gods who gifted these waters with their essence.
  • Today, skilled pearl farmers continue this legacy with respect for the sea and its creatures.

Their|Theyr work entails meticulously selecting oysters, implanting tiny pearl nuclei, and monitoring their growth during many months. The result is a breathtaking display of nature's artistry – iridescent pearls that capture the very essence within the South Pacific.
